elasticsearch - 如何在 elasticsearch 中只存储有限数量的文档。

标签 elasticsearch go elasticsearch-5

我只需要在特定索引下存储 10 个数字文档。第 11 项应替换旧项,即第 1 项。这样我在任何时候都只有 10 个文档。 我在 golang 中使用 elacticsearch

最佳答案

如果您只想存储 10 个文档,那么您应该应用 algo = (document no%10)+1。返回值是您的 elasticsearch _id 字段算法仅返回 1 到 10。并始终对其进行索引。

关于elasticsearch - 如何在 elasticsearch 中只存储有限数量的文档。,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49358749/

相关文章:

elasticsearch - 多个索引上的ElasticSearch分页

unit-testing - 为归档函数 fs 创建单元测试

go - 创建跨包可见的常量,可直接访问

go - 在 go 中测试连接到 db 的处理程序

elasticsearch - 在具有2GB RAM的计算机上引导elasticsearch

elasticsearch - 框架 3.5 的嵌套 dll

elasticsearch - Kibana搜索分析器

php - 用于 PHP 的 Elasticsearch 查询

elasticsearch - Elasticsearch 如何分析其中包含 '-'的URL/单词

python - 如何使用 SSL 将 PySpark 连接到 Elasticsearch 并验证设置为 False 的证书?